Securing and Verifying Vendor Banking Details Used For Target Payments in Corporate B2B Transactions

Corporate financial controllers frequently face reconciliation bottlenecks when handling massive volumes of international settlements. Accurately managing vendor banking details used for target payments acts as the foundational layer for seamless fund routing across distinct regulatory jurisdictions. When procurement departments initiate large-scale procurement cycles, the treasury team must execute corresponding wire transfers with zero margin for error. Discrepancies in alphanumeric account strings or misaligned beneficiary domiciles trigger immediate payment rejections, resulting in severe supply chain disruptions. Establishing a robust protocol for collecting, storing, and validating payee credentials ensures that outbound liquidity reaches the intended recipient without incurring excessive intermediary bank fees or extended manual compliance reviews.

How Do Treasury Teams Validate Vendor Banking Details Used For Target Payments To Mitigate Business Email Compromise?

Financial departments actively combat external fraud vectors by implementing rigorous verification protocols before executing any outbound liquidity transfer. Business Email Compromise represents a highly sophisticated threat where malicious actors intercept procurement communications and distribute fraudulent invoices containing altered routing instructions. To neutralize this risk, treasury analysts refuse to accept account modifications exclusively through digital correspondence. Instead, organizations mandate a multi-channel authentication process. When a supplier requests an update to their settlement instructions, the accounts payable unit initiates an outbound voice verification call to a pre-established, trusted contact number documented within the enterprise resource planning master file.

Beyond voice verification, procurement divisions deploy system-level segregation of duties. The administrative staff member responsible for updating the vendor banking details used for target payments cannot possess the system privileges required to authorize the actual fund disbursement. This maker-checker framework forces a secondary review phase where a senior treasury manager scrutinizes the modified payee credentials against standardized banking letters or voided cheques provided during the initial supplier onboarding phase. By strictly separating data entry from payment execution, corporations drastically reduce the statistical probability of unauthorized capital flight.

What Role Does Micro-Deposit Verification Play in International Beneficiary Onboarding?

Executing zero-dollar pre-notes or micro-deposit transactions provides an empirical method to confirm account ownership without exposing the enterprise to material financial loss. Financial operations teams initiate a marginal transfer, typically under one dollar or its foreign currency equivalent, to the newly registered payee account. The supplier must subsequently access their institutional portal and report the exact fractional amount deposited, alongside the specific alphanumeric reference code embedded within the transaction remittance data.

This bidirectional validation mechanism physically proves that the designated corporate entity maintains active administrative control over the receiving ledger. While this procedure introduces a delay of one to three business days in the onboarding cycle, it mathematically eliminates the possibility of routing bulk invoice settlements into fraudulent or dormant accounts. Organizations handling high-frequency cross-border payouts embed this micro-deposit logic directly into their automated supplier portals, requiring successful matching before the system unlocks the payee profile for active invoicing.

What Are The Technical Specifications Required For Cross-Border Supplier Information Configuration?

Executing cross-border settlements demands absolute precision regarding alphanumeric data string structures. Standardizing supplier profiles requires deep comprehension of regional clearing mechanisms. European counterparties mandate the International Bank Account Number format, which incorporates specific country codes, checksum digits, and local branch identifiers into a single continuous string. Conversely, routing funds to North American suppliers necessitates a distinct separation between the nine-digit American Bankers Association routing transit number and the specific account ledger identifier. Furthermore, transacting with Asian manufacturing hubs involves collecting specific branch-level clearing codes, such as the China National Advanced Payment System code, to ensure localized straight-through processing.

Failure to align the collected data with the exact structural requirements of the receiving country's central banking infrastructure results in mandatory manual intervention by intermediary correspondent banks. These financial institutions levy lifting fees for correcting poorly formatted instructions. Accounts payable teams must utilize dynamic data validation fields within their procurement software, which automatically run algorithmic checksums on inputted Swift Bank Identifier Codes to verify institutional existence and branch-level accuracy before the data ever reaches the treasury execution queue.

How Do Character Encodings and Truncations Cause Settlement Failures?

Legacy banking infrastructure often operates on restricted character encoding standards, primarily limited to basic ASCII frameworks. When treasury departments capture payee names containing diacritics, special characters, or non-Latin scripts, the translation matrix between the corporate enterprise system and the global SWIFT network can inadvertently generate unrecognized symbols. A payee name registered as a specific legal entity in a local jurisdiction might undergo automated transliteration that strips critical corporate designations (such as GmbH, S.A., or Ltd) or truncates the string due to the 35-character field limit within traditional MT103 messaging structures.

Such technical truncation flags the transaction during the receiving institution's algorithmic sanctions screening process. Compliance officers at the beneficiary bank will freeze the incoming funds, issuing a formal Request for Information to the originating corporate treasury. Resolving these character-driven discrepancies requires deploying ISO 20022 XML messaging standards, which utilize extended `<Cdtr>` and `<CdtrAcct>` data tags capable of holding richer, more complex alphanumeric strings without arbitrary data truncation.

How Can Procurement Departments Automate The Collection Of Overseas Payee Credentials?

Relying on decentralized email threads or PDF attachments to gather sensitive settlement instructions exposes the organization to severe data fragmentation. Modern corporate architectures deploy centralized vendor portals that shift the data entry burden directly onto the supplier. These encrypted web environments require suppliers to authenticate their institutional identity using multi-factor protocols before inputting their financial data. The system enforces rigid data taxonomy, preventing the submission of incomplete profiles by utilizing conditional logic based on the selected beneficiary domicile.

These portals inherently synchronize via secure application programming interfaces directly with the central master data management module. By eliminating manual transcription by internal accounts payable staff, the organization removes human keystroke errors. The automated workflow also cross-references the submitted institutional names against global corporate registries, verifying that the legal entity invoicing the enterprise perfectly matches the registered owner of the designated receiving account.

How Does Infrastructure Optimization Accelerate Fund Routing Using Consolidated Account Data?

Strategic deployment of specialized financial infrastructure dramatically accelerates the lifecycle of transnational corporate settlements. Traditional correspondent banking models rely on sequential processing through multiple intermediary institutions, each applying independent compliance checks and extracting operational fees. By consolidating master data management and utilizing direct clearing access, corporate treasuries bypass these redundant intermediary layers. The physical location of the liquidity disbursement system must align with the target market's local clearing windows to achieve same-day execution capability.

What Compliance Mandates Dictate The Processing Of Transnational Supplier Identity Records?

Regulatory authorities continuously tighten the operational frameworks governing institutional fund flows to combat illicit financing. Adherence to the Financial Action Task Force Recommendation 16, commonly referred to as the Travel Rule, requires originating corporations to transmit highly specific, verified originator and beneficiary data alongside the payment message. Treasury divisions must ensure their internal databases dynamically capture the precise legal operating name, physical registered address, and national identification numbers of their overseas counterparties.

Simultaneously, financial teams must run continuous batch screenings of their active supplier master files against global sanctions lists, including those published by the Office of Foreign Assets Control and the European Union. Because legal entities frequently undergo ownership restructuring, an organization cannot rely on static, one-time onboarding checks. Automated systems must ping the existing vendor banking details used for target payments against daily updated sanction databases. Any algorithmic match immediately triggers a system-level block, preventing the accounts payable module from generating an automated payment file for the flagged entity until a rigorous manual compliance review clears the alert.

How Do Companies Reconcile Discrepancies Between Invoiced Entities and Beneficiary Account Holders?

Complex supply chain structures often involve trading subsidiaries, localized manufacturing arms, and offshore holding companies. This corporate fragmentation creates immense reconciliation challenges when the legal entity issuing the commercial invoice differs from the legal entity registered to the receiving settlement account. Financial compliance policies generally dictate that funds must be transferred strictly to the exact entity listed on the binding commercial contract. When a discrepancy occurs, treasury systems automatically suspend the transaction file, classifying it as a high-risk third-party payment.

To systematically resolve these justifiable discrepancies without violating anti-money laundering protocols, procurement teams must obtain formalized legal documentation. The primary contracted supplier must provide a notarized letter of authorization explicitly assigning collection rights to the alternative corporate entity. This document must clearly define the corporate relationship between the two entities, often requiring a diagram of the ultimate beneficial ownership structure. Accounts payable teams attach this digitized documentation directly to the vendor banking details used for target payments within the enterprise system, providing clear audit trails for internal controllers and external financial regulators.

Which Exception Handling Protocols Minimize FX Exposure During Return Transfers?

When an international settlement fails due to inaccurate payee parameters, the principal funds undergo a repatriation process. During this return cycle, the corporate treasury remains heavily exposed to foreign exchange volatility. If the original transfer involved a conversion from US Dollars to Euros, the returning bank will execute a reverse conversion at the spot rate active at the moment of failure, not the rate locked during the initial transaction. This dual-conversion process mathematically guarantees a financial loss, compounded by intermediary lifting fees deducted from the principal.

Treasury management systems minimize this exposure by deploying automated exception handling protocols. Rather than allowing the funds to automatically convert back to the base currency, the system configures instructions requesting the correspondent institution to hold the funds in a temporary suspense account. The accounts payable team receives an urgent system-generated alert, granting them a narrow time window, typically 24 to 48 hours, to transmit an MT199 amendment message containing the corrected settlement instructions. Executing an amendment prevents the capital from undergoing adverse reverse currency conversions.

Which Technical Systems Automatically Synchronize Vendor Payment Information With Banking Portals?

Manual data uploads via comma-separated values files present significant operational hazards, including file tampering and formatting corruption. Enterprise financial architectures establish secure, machine-to-machine connectivity utilizing Host-to-Host protocols or advanced RESTful APIs. These connections create a synchronized bi-directional data flow between the internal master data management software and the external institutional banking portals. When an authorized administrator updates a supplier's SWIFT BIC within the internal environment, the API webhook instantaneously pushes the modified data package to the banking infrastructure.

This automated synchronization guarantees that the treasury execution module consistently draws from a single source of truth. The integration layer applies sophisticated cryptographic algorithms, such as RSA or AES-256 encryption, ensuring the data payloads remain entirely illegible if intercepted during transmission. Furthermore, these API endpoints facilitate real-time payment status tracking. Once the banking portal processes the payment file, it returns standardized status codes directly into the enterprise resource planning software, allowing accounts payable clerks to monitor settlement progress without manually accessing distinct external bank interfaces.

How Does API Integration Reduce Manual Data Entry Errors?

Human transcription remains the primary source of failed settlement routing. Manually copying thirty-four character IBAN strings from a PDF invoice into an online banking terminal introduces unacceptably high error rates. API integration fundamentally eliminates this mechanical process. The enterprise resource planning software generates a structured payment file, typically formatted as an ISO 20022 PAIN.001 XML document, which algorithmically maps the validated payee parameters directly into the precise fields required by the execution terminal.

The banking portal executes automated schema validations the millisecond it receives the API payload. If the structural logic of the submitted data violates the predefined clearing rules—such as a mismatch between the country code embedded in the IBAN and the designated country code of the beneficiary bank—the API immediately returns a negative acknowledgment code. This synchronous error trapping prevents defective instructions from entering the live processing queue, saving treasury personnel from engaging in costly post-execution investigations.

How Can Businesses Efficiently Audit Vendor Banking Details Used For Target Payments Before Year-End Closing?

Maintaining long-term data hygiene requires systematic, scheduled auditing of the entire supplier database. As corporate entities merge, rebrand, or change financial partners, static historical data rapidly decays into an operational liability. As financial departments approach the critical year-end closing period, relying on outdated settlement instructions creates severe bottlenecks that delay statutory reporting and disrupt cash flow forecasting. Implementing a continuous auditing framework is essential to purge obsolete routing configurations and reaffirm the accuracy of active institutional relationships.

Audit controllers utilize automated scripts to analyze transaction histories, isolating vendor banking details used for target payments that have remained dormant for exceeding twelve months. These inactive profiles face automatic system deprecation, requiring a complete compliance re-onboarding process before any future invoice can be processed. For active suppliers, the system automatically dispatches secure digital questionnaires requesting re-certification of their existing financial routing logic. By treating payee credentials as dynamic, strictly monitored assets rather than static text fields, enterprise treasuries successfully shield their supply chains from fraud, eliminate unnecessary intermediary deductions, and guarantee high-velocity execution of all transnational B2B settlements.
